Paschal Donohoe (Dublin Central, Fine Gael) | Oireachtas source
I absolutely accept the importance of the individual issues the Deputy has raised, but his statement regarding schools that are unable to provide education does not tally with the quality of education and teaching that happens across our schools in this country. I am not denying for a moment that there are issues that many schools confront but what we have seen is, with regard to the funding that is available to the Department of Education, the money they spend and the teachers that are available to them, the investment levels have gone up year after year. I know the Minister, Deputy McEntee, will continue to do all she can with the funding available to her to respond to the important issues many schools are facing at the moment. We have never spent so much on our schools as we are spending at the moment because we have never had so many reasons to be reminded of how important our schools are at the moment.
